## Deploying FlagPilot

FlagPilot controls staged rollouts for Merrowave apps. Support should know: flags update within 60 seconds, kill switches are instant, and percentage ramps pause automatically on error spikes. Escalate stuck rollouts to the on-call owner. For troubleshooting customer reports, the current rollout configuration values are listed below.

config for kafof-bawef:
holath:
  log_level: debug
  metrics_host: metrics.holath.qorvelsys.internal
  pin: 2191
  pool_size: 32

## 2.14.0 — Setting renamed

The `LEDGERLOOM_SWAP_MODE` setting is now `LEDGERLOOM_BLUEGREEN_STRATEGY`, affecting how the billing worker drains jobs during blue-green cutovers. On-call: the old name is silently ignored as of this release, so stalled drains after deploy usually mean the rename was missed. Update both color environments, not just the active one. The worker also now requires the following line in its env file.

vault entry, yajop-bafop: ARCHIVE_KEY3=8d4

**Build Provenance: ReportSmith sort stability**

Reviewers verifying ReportSmith output must confirm the grouping stage uses a stable sort; earlier builds swapped equal-keyed rows nondeterministically, breaking diff-based provenance checks. Compare two consecutive builds of the same dataset and confirm byte-identical ordering. The reference build used for verification is recorded below.

trace token, fafog-kageg: htk4_98e6